不同拌和方法的沥青混合料路用性能对比

摘    要:为了研究两阶段拌和对沥青混合料的影响,采用试验评价与细观图像处理技术,对常规拌和与两阶段拌和的沥青混合料路用性能及细观结构进行分析。研究内容包括:两阶段拌和的最佳沥青掺配比确定、常规拌和与两阶段拌和的沥青混合料力学性能对比、不同拌和方法的试件断面细观结构分析。研究结果表明,两阶段拌和对大粒径和大空隙的沥青混合料力学性能提升明显,水稳性和耐高温性有明显提高。研究成果对两阶段拌和的沥青混合料应用具有一定的参考价值。

Comparative study on road performance of asphalt mixture with different mixing methods

Abstract:In order to study the influence of two-stage mixing on asphalt mixture, the road performance and meso-structure of conventional and two-stage mixing asphalt mixture were analyzed by experimental evaluation and meso-image processing technology. The research contents include: the determination of the optimal asphalt mixing ratio for two-stage mixing, the comparison of mechanical properties between conventional and two-stage mixing asphalt mixtures, and the analysis of meso-structure of specimen sections with different mixing methods. The results show that the mechanical properties, water stability and high temperature resistance of the asphalt mixture with large particle size and large voids are significantly improved by two-stage mixing. The research results have certain reference value for the application of two-stage mixing asphalt mixture.
